POKHARA, April 13: Hotels based in a touristic town Pokhara have been packed with domestic tourists on the eve of the Nepali New Year- 2074 BS. Hoteliers here are busy welcoming guests.
According to the Western Regional Hotel Association outgoing chair and Pokhara Tourism Council vice chair Bharat Raj Parajuli, rooms in all hotels in the town have been booked for today and tomorrow as domestic tourists continue to flock to this city rich in natural beauty to celebrate the Nepali New Year (Baisakh 1).
This tourist arrival has elated hotel owners in the area with their hotels occupied fully. However, arrival of foreign tourists in the aftermath of the Gorkha earthquake is not satisfactory, he added. There are around 500 hotels (including five five-star and 14 three-star) in the town that have been opened to particularly serve tourists. RSS
